By concerning 1300 and 1340 the oud experienced develop into modified plenty of by Europeans to be a different and distinctive instrument, the medieval lute. By slightly immediately after c. 1400, western lutes ended up ever more fretted and by 1481 the medieval lute had created in to the renaissance lute, An important western instrument in the time period, by then mirroring the importance of the oud in the east.

We all know, for instance, that ouds played a very important component while in the musical lifetime of the royal court of Castile (in modern-day Spain) in the 13th century and, by extension, Just about unquestionably Iberian musical daily life generally speaking.
Musicologist Richard Dumbrill right now employs the phrase more categorically to discuss devices that existed millennia ahead of the expression "lute" was coined.[26] Dumbrill documented in excess of 3000 yrs of iconographic proof to the lutes in Mesopotamia, in his ebook The Archaeomusicology of the Ancient Close to East. Based on Dumbrill, the lute family members integrated instruments in Mesopotamia before 3000 BC.[27] He points to the cylinder seal trap music as proof; courting from c. 3100 BC or earlier (now in the possession of your British Museum); the seal depicts on just one aspect what exactly is thought to be a girl playing a adhere "lute".
The first evidence of devices we can definitely say are ouds are within the art of your Sassanid era of Iran, the last Iranian empire prior to the increase of Islam, from CE 224 to music 651.

In the event the Umayyads conquered Hispania in 711, they brought their ud along. An oud is depicted as remaining played by a seated musician[33] in Qasr Amra in the Umayyad dynasty, among the list of earliest depictions of your instrument as played in early Islamic background.
For most of its history and in many areas, the oud has become fretless and, even in Iran, the abandonment of frets began to happen in the 16th century.
